    This is being called out as an error:

    $(window).scroll(function() {

    // Run on scroll.
    animateObject();

    });

    What is the 'modern' way to write this it looks correct to me :/ ??

    I want to make a correction to my above first post it's not being called an error it's being asked about because the way the function is written is being deprecated; does anyone have any other thoughts on this?

    I think the fix is easy. Change to:

    .on( 'scroll', function()
